Release Notes:
This Rom is the Official OTA for the HTC Droid Incredible (OG)
All bugs from the previous OTA appear to be fixed now. This build did not require any intervention on my part. I just had to build it
Specs: OTA Ver: 4.08.605.2 Android Ver: 2.3.4 Sense Ver: 1.0 Baseband: 2.15.10.07.07 Kernel: 2.6.35.13-g03546aahtc-kernel@and18-2 #1 Fri Oct7 10:52:52 CST 2011
Other Specs:
Rooted
Zipaligned
Deodexed
init.d support: Devs, just drop your scripts in and go.
data/app support

Installation Instructions
NOTE: I use CWMR 5X. Some wipe options below are not included in earlier recovery versions. Still wipe what is available the best you can.
1. Put the Rom on the root of your SD Card
2. Compare MD5 Sum
Windows: MD5 Calculator
LINUX: Open Terminal and type: md5sum [path to the rom on your sd card]
Mac: Open a terminal and type: md5 [path to the rom on your sd card]
3. Reboot to Recovery
4. Wipe these: Main Screen:
wipe data/factory reset - x2
wipe cache partition - x2
Mounts and Storage:
Format-
/boot - x2
/system - x2
/datadata - x2
/data - x2
/cache - x2
5. Install Rom from SD Card by going back and selecting install from SD card.
6. Reboot and enjoy!
PLEASE NOTE: THIS IS THE FULL ROM. THIS GETS FLASHED IN CLOCKWORK RECOVERY JUST LIKE OTHER ROMS. NOT IN HBOOT.

Ha, I seen your PM on XDA and did reply. One thing you may get by reading my PM is, you might want to back up your apps with titanium back up and then do the nandroid back up in clockwork recovery. Titanium back up allows you to restore your apps after you have your new rom and the nandroid backup allows you to restore your current rom just like it is right now just in case something goes wrong.

Here ya go guys, I went ahead and made a flashable that will activate native screenshot for you on this rom. Just simply drop the flashable on your sd card and flash through clockwork recovery. Don't worry about wiping anything. Just flash it. Please note that after flashing the mod your phone will take an excessive amount of time to boot on the first boot after the flash. For me it took about 3 minutes. This is only on the first boot so every boot afterwards will be normal.
You would take a screenshot by pressing and holding down the power button and tapping the home softkey and then releasing the power button. It will pop up a system notice stating the screenshot was taken and where it is stored. To view your screenshot, simply go to your gallery and select all pictures. Your screenshot will be at the very end.
Please note that if it appears to hang after you have performed the actions to take a screenshot just give it a couple seconds. Its processing and the hang is normal occasionally.
Good deal. Just make sure that you upgrade your recovery to the latest version BEFORE you make a nandroid. Nandroids made in the 3 series recoveries are not compatible with the 5 series recoveries.
